Cathie Wood Watch: Here's What Ark Is Buying and Selling

On Aug. 9 Ark Invest sold a total of $28.9 million worth of Roku  (ROKU) – Get Free Report, one of the firm’s largest holdings. Ark Innovation was responsible for the bulk of the sell-off, dropping 280,826 shares — valued at around $22.9 million — of the company. 

Ark Next Generation Internet dumped a further 61,652 shares of Roku and Ark Fintech Innovation dumped 12,039 shares.

Ark has been cutting its holdings in Roku heavily over the past week. The sell-off began Aug. 3, when Ark sold $13 million worth of the tech company. A few days later, the firm cut its Roku holdings by less than $2 million. Ark continued the Roku trim Aug. 7, reducing its holdings by $14 million

Ark’s latest Roku trim is its biggest cut for the week — Ark has reduced its holdings in Roku by more than $50 million. 

Still, Roku remains the firm’s second-largest holding, with Ark Innovation owning 8.25 million shares worth $674.1 million and weighted at 8.59% of the fund. The day before, Ark Innovation’s Roku holding was weighted at more than 9% of the fund.

Though Roku is up more than 100% for the year, the company’s stock tumbled around 5% Aug. 9.

Ark also trimmed its holdings in Nvidia  (NVDA) – Get Free Report, the chip giant, by around $2.7 million. Nvidia’s stock has traced a meteoric rise throughout 2023 — on Aug. 8, company CEO Jensen Huang revealed a new super chip, the GH200, which is designed to further accelerate AI-driven computing as the company works to be the leading pioneer in the coming expansion of cloud computing.

Nvidia fell 4.7% Aug. 9 to close at $425.54 per share.
